
In Iowa, with its primary service area centered around Davenport, garage door replacement projects are significantly influenced by a continental climate featuring cold, snowy winters and warm, humid summers. This seasonal variability necessitates garage doors constructed from materials that can withstand extreme temperature fluctuations, moisture, and potential impact from winter debris. The housing stock, often comprising traditional Midwestern homes, requires durable and insulating solutions to maintain interior comfort and energy efficiency throughout the year.
The selection of garage door materials in Iowa is crucial for mitigating the effects of its distinct seasons. Insulated steel or composite doors are frequently specified to provide superior thermal resistance against frigid winter temperatures and the oppressive humidity of summer, thereby reducing HVAC operational load. Considerations for panel design include resistance to ice buildup and the ability to maintain structural integrity under significant snow accumulation. The operational hardware, particularly spring systems, must be robust enough to function reliably in sub-zero conditions.

The most economical garage door replacements typically involve uninsulated, single-layer steel or aluminum panels, often featuring a basic, non-decorative design. While offering fundamental protection, these options may provide less thermal insulation and may not be as robust against physical impact as multi-layer or reinforced alternatives. The overall cost is influenced by material gauge, panel style, and the hardware selected for operation.
The cost of garage door repair in Iowa is primarily dictated by the complexity of the issue and the specific components requiring attention. Minor adjustments to tracks or sensors are generally less expensive than replacing damaged panels, spring systems, or malfunctioning opener mechanisms. The necessity for specialized tools or replacement parts also contributes to the overall expenditure, underscoring the value of a detailed assessment.

The expenditure associated with installing a new garage door in Iowa is contingent upon several factors, including the chosen door material, its size and design, and the complexity of the installation process. Higher-end materials like solid wood or insulated steel, coupled with intricate panel designs or specialized hardware, will naturally incur greater costs. The existing structural framework and the need for new opener system integration also play a significant role.
